Tech

What Are the Steps to Create a Website From Start to Finish?

Creating a website from scratch can feel overwhelming, especially if you’re new to the process. Whether you’re building a site for your business, your portfolio, or a new idea you want to bring online, the journey becomes much easier once you understand the clear steps involved. Every website whether small and simple or large and complex goes through the same core stages, from planning to launch.

In this guide, we’ll walk through each step, supported by real case studies and industry insights, so you can understand how a professional website comes to life from start to finish.

Step 1: Define Your Purpose and Goals

Every website project begins with clarity. Before design or development starts, you need to answer key questions:

  • What is the main purpose of the website?

  • Who is the target audience?

  • What do you want visitors to do on the website?

  • Will it be informational, interactive, or e-commerce focused?

Case Study: Local Bakery Website

A small neighborhood bakery wanted a simple website that displayed their menu and allowed customers to place basic inquiries online. While exploring inspiration, the owners browsed websites of nearby businesses and noticed how clean and user-friendly some professionally built local sites were especially ones done by agencies experienced in projects like web design Richmond. Observing these examples helped them clarify the layout and features they wanted. With that clarity, the planning stage for their website moved quickly, and they finalized a structure in under a week.

Having a clear purpose early on always leads to smoother development.

Step 2: Conduct Research & Competitor Analysis

Research helps you understand:

  • What your target audience expects

  • What industry trends look like

  • Which features are essential

  • Where your competitors are doing well (or poorly)

This step shapes your website’s functionality and design direction.

What to research:

  • Competitor websites

  • User behavior patterns

  • Must-have features

  • Market gaps your site can fill

Case Study: Fitness Trainer Website

A fitness trainer planned to sell workout plans and offer online classes. Research showed that competitor websites relied heavily on video content and straightforward booking tools. This insight guided the layout, feature list, and homepage structure, making the final website more aligned with user preferences.

Step 3: Build the Website Structure (Sitemap)

A sitemap is the blueprint of your website. It outlines:

  • What pages you need

  • How they connect to each other

  • How users navigate the website

Common pages include:

  • Home

  • About

  • Services

  • Blog

  • Contact

A clean, logical structure ensures your visitors find information easily.

Step 4: Create Wireframes

Wireframes are like architectural sketches of your website. They show layout, placement of elements, and page flow without focusing on design details like colors and fonts.

Why wireframes matter:

  • They prevent early design mistakes

  • They align the team on the structure

  • They make development smoother

Wireframes give you a clear picture before visual design begins.

Step 5: Design the Website (UI/UX)

After wireframes are approved, designers begin working on the visual experience.

UI/UX design includes:

  • Color palette

  • Typography

  • Page layouts

  • Buttons and forms

  • Imagery and graphics

  • Branding elements

Good UI attracts visitors; good UX keeps them engaged.

Case Study: Tech Startup Landing Page

A startup wanted a modern landing page to highlight its new app. After several rounds of UX-focused adjustments refining the hero section, making feature sections more visual, and simplifying navigation the final design increased user sign-ups by 38%. This shows how design choices directly impact engagement and conversions.

Step 6: Develop the Website

Once the design is approved, developers turn it into a fully functional website.

Frontend Development Includes:

  • HTML

  • CSS

  • JavaScript

  • Animations

  • Responsive layouts

Backend Development Includes:

  • Servers

  • Databases

  • User authentication

  • APIs

  • Dashboards

Popular Platforms:

  • WordPress

  • Webflow

  • Shopify

  • Custom-built frameworks

Case Study: E-commerce Clothing Brand

A clothing brand needed an online store with product filters, secure checkout, inventory management, and mobile optimization. Development took six weeks and involved:

  • Shopify setup

  • Custom theme coding

  • Payment gateway integration

  • Product catalog structuring

The website launched smoothly and performed well from day one.

Step 7: Content Creation & Upload

This step is often underestimated but crucial.

Website content includes:

  • Page copy

  • Blogs

  • Product descriptions

  • Images and videos

  • Testimonials

Why content matters:

  • It communicates value

  • It supports SEO

  • It guides the user journey

Many delays happen because businesses don’t prepare content early—so starting this step alongside design is ideal.

Step 8: Test the Website (Quality Assurance)

Testing ensures the website works smoothly on every device and browser.

QA Checklist:

  • Mobile responsiveness

  • Page load speed

  • Browser compatibility

  • Form submissions

  • Navigation flow

  • Security checks

  • Fixing broken links

Case Study: Hotel Booking Website

A hotel’s website had multiple issues during QA booking forms didn’t work properly on Safari and some images weren’t loading on certain Android devices. Early detection helped fix these problems before launch, preventing customer frustration and booking losses.

Step 9: Launch the Website

Launching includes:

  • Connecting the domain

  • Configuring hosting

  • Installing SSL

  • Setting up basic SEO

  • Speed optimization

  • Final quality checks

Once everything is ready, the site goes live.

Your website is now accessible to the world.

Step 10: Maintain & Update the Website

A website is not a “one-time project.”
It requires:

  • Regular updates

  • Backups

  • Performance checks

  • Plugin updates

  • New content

  • Security improvements

Without proper maintenance, websites slow down or become vulnerable over time.

Case Study: Real Estate Agency

A real estate business uploaded new property photos regularly. Over time, this slowed down loading speed significantly. Through routine maintenance image compression, caching, and code optimization the team restored fast performance.

How Long Does the Entire Website Process Take?

Website Type

Estimated Timeline

Simple 5-page website

2–4 weeks

Standard business website

4–8 weeks

E-commerce website

6–12 weeks

Complex custom website

3–6 months

Timelines vary based on complexity, content readiness, and revisions.

Conclusion

Creating a website from start to finish is a structured journey involving planning, research, design, development, testing, and ongoing maintenance. Each step plays a vital role in ensuring your website performs well, looks professional, and aligns with your goals.

Whether you’re building your very first website or planning to upgrade an existing one, understanding this process helps you make smarter decisions and achieve better results.

If you’d like expert help in creating or improving your website, feel free to visit us at JanBask Digital Design.